Output 21a6b7028c641fe8a3f56fbb601b9c43925cb3ccc973b00d01da760b7fb45228:3

value
6518100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c2670be9b10bbd33c0f494972bdd8521c6870de OP_EQUAL
address
3LJTpZe4vD5A7SdZ2i3CAtyv5UjkvqTHAt
transaction
21a6b7028c641fe8a3f56fbb601b9c43925cb3ccc973b00d01da760b7fb45228
spent
true